How not to miss the landmarks of New York?

Welcome to the district of excess: the district of Midtown.

Renowned for Times Square which earned it its nickname 'the city that never sleeps', this district is also known for its frenetic race to the sky with taller buildings, for its dynamism and for its iconic monuments.

Through this course, you will explore the evolution of Midtown architecture, discover its history that is particularly marked by the passage of very wealthy industrialists and finally, learn more about the life of a New Yorker.
